Synopsis
The Vultures is a Canadian drama film, directed by Jean-Claude Labrecque and released in 1975. Set in 1959 at the end of the Maurice Duplessis era in Quebec politics, the film centres on Louis Pelletier, a young man whose mother has just died, and who is coping with a trio of aunts who are much more interested in what they stand to inherit from their sister's estate than in supporting their nephew.
